Reach Out WorldWide (ROWW): The Mission That Continues to Save Lives
While Paul Walker was a global movie star, his true passion lay in disaster relief and humanitarian work. In 2010, following the devastating earthquake in Haiti, Walker founded Reach Out WorldWide (ROWW), a non-profit organization dedicated to deploying rapid-response teams to areas affected by natural disasters. This was the event he was leaving when his fatal car accident occurred on November 30, 2013—a fundraiser for his charity.
Today, ROWW is helmed by Paul’s brother, Cody Walker, who has continued the mission with the same dedication and hands-on approach that Paul demonstrated. Cody has frequently spoken about how continuing ROWW is the ultimate way to honor his brother. The organization remains active, providing skilled volunteers, including paramedics, builders, and doctors, to disaster zones worldwide, often being one of the first groups to arrive and assist in recovery efforts.
The continuity of ROWW serves as a powerful reminder of the man behind the movie star. As Cody Walker has shared, he would tell Paul that “his legacy is continuing on” and that the organization he created “is still alive and well and still helping people all over the world.” It is in the trenches of disaster zones, far from the red carpets of Hollywood, that Paul Walker’s truest and most impactful legacy is being written every day.
Brian O’Conner’s Eternal Ride: The Character’s Future in the Franchise
Even as the Fast & Furious franchise races toward its ultimate conclusion with the upcoming final installments, the question of Brian O’Conner’s presence remains a critical creative and emotional challenge. Following Walker’s death, his brothers, Cody and Caleb Walker, stepped in as stand-ins to help complete the filming of Furious 7, a profound effort that allowed the character a poignant, respectful send-off that saw Brian retire from the action to focus on his family.
However, the character’s legacy is too central to simply be left in the past. Brian O’Conner remains alive within the universe, and his presence is felt through occasional mentions, archived footage, and even subtle appearances. For instance, archive footage from Fast Five was utilized for a flashback scene in Fast X.
As the franchise wraps up, producers and the cast face the delicate balance of honoring the character without exploiting the tragedy. The prevailing consensus seems to be that as long as the story calls for it, and as long as it’s done respectfully and in consultation with the Walker family, Brian O’Conner’s spirit—often symbolized by a signature blue Nissan Skyline—will continue to influence the narrative, ensuring the ‘brotherhood’ remains the thematic core of the entire saga. The challenge is not in bringing him back, but in showing that his influence is so great that he never truly left.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: When did Paul Walker die and how old was he?
Paul Walker died on November 30, 2013, in a single-vehicle car crash in Santa Clarita, California. He was 40 years old at the time of his death.
Q2: What is Paul Walker’s daughter, Meadow Walker, currently doing?
Meadow Walker is a successful model and the founder of The Paul Walker Foundation, which focuses on marine conservation and providing grants to students pursuing marine science. She has also made a cameo appearance in the Fast & Furious franchise film, Fast X.
Q3: Is the charity Paul Walker founded still active?
Yes. Paul Walker founded the non-profit organization Reach Out WorldWide (ROWW) in 2010. The organization remains fully active, providing disaster relief and essential aid to areas affected by natural calamities, and is currently led by his brother, Cody Walker.
Q4: Will Brian O’Conner appear in future Fast & Furious movies?
While the character Brian O’Conner was given a definitive, respectful retirement in Furious 7, the character is still alive within the movie universe. The franchise has maintained his presence through mentions, archive footage, and emotional tributes, such as Meadow Walker’s cameo in Fast X. It is highly likely his legacy will continue to be a thematic element in the final installments of the saga.
